Thousands of people have taken part in several events outside Lledoners prison over the weekend to bid farewell to the Catalan pro-independence jailed leaders, who will be transferred to Madrid prisons for their upcoming trial in the next few days.

On Sunday at noon a concert joined by hundreds of folksingers was held to "support" the nine officials incarcerated.

"We hope they return soon, but freed, and not inside prisons, we hope they are given justice," said Anna Rosés, a folksinger of Orfeó Català, an iconic, old coral group in the country.

On Saturday, another gathering was joined by some eighty groups of 'gegants', or giant figures, traditional characters in local celebrations and parades.
